	abstract = {Background: Thyroid granulomas are uncommon and published data are limited to case reports or narrow single-etiology series, leaving the clinical significance of incidentally identified granulomas poorly defined. The aim of this study was to describe a mixed-etiology cohort of thyroid granulomas to characterize their clinical presentation, histopathologic patterns, and association with malignancy at a single tertiary center.Methods: A single-center retrospective cross-sectional study was performed of adult patients undergoing thyroid surgery between January 1, 2008, and December 31, 2023 with pathology-confirmed granulomatous inflammation involving thyroid tissue. Cases were identified via electronic medical record query. Demographic, clinical, cytologic, and histopathologic data were summarized using descriptive statistics.Results: Twenty-five patients met inclusion criteria. Median age at surgery was 57.2 years (range, 24.3–85.8 years); 72% (18/25) were female. The most common indication for surgery was thyroid nodules (60%, 15/25), followed by suspected or confirmed malignancy (24%, 6/25). Fine needle aspiration (FNA) was performed in 92% (23/25) of patients; 43% (10/23) yielded indeterminate cytology (Bethesda III–IV). Most granulomas were incidental histologic findings (88%, 22/25). Three presented as mass-forming lesions, all yielding Bethesda III cytology that prompted surgical excision. All granulomas were non-necrotizing. Granulomas reflected diverse, predominantly noninfectious histopathologic patterns, most commonly autoimmune or thyroiditis-associated and post-procedural. Coexisting malignancy was identified in 9 patients (36%, 9/25), most commonly papillary thyroid carcinoma. Among these 9 patients, 4 had a history of sarcoidosis; within the sarcoidosis subgroup, 4 of 5 patients had malignancy (80%, 4/5). Given the small subgroup size, this finding should be interpreted cautiously. Special stains for infectious organisms were negative in all tested cases (n=11). No patient developed recurrence of thyroid granulomatous disease over a median follow-up of 12.4 months.Conclusions: In this surgically treated cohort, thyroid granulomas were most often incidental, and reflected diverse, predominantly noninfectious histopathologic patterns. Mass-forming granulomas may mimic malignancy on imaging and cytology despite benign histology, and recognition of this pattern may help avoid misclassification. The association between sarcoidosis and concurrent malignancy is a preliminary finding warranting prospective investigation.},
